BSD is where a number of Jakartans go early in the morning during the weekends – specifically to Pasar Modern.  However, when you just want a relaxing way to shop after  getting rid of the stress, Pasar Delapan is a great venue to tone down and replenish the calories you just burned.   My usual weekend routine consists of a jog in Alam Sutera and a short visit to the market for some essentials.  However, one weekend I deviated from my lethal regimen and tried one of the breakfast spots in Pasar 8 that is always full: The Kopi Tiam

IMG_2911

This nook never runs out of patrons.  It follows a very simple formula: customers are welcome to order food from other vendors provided, of course, that they buy from them.  Simple yet powerful as this spot is never empty.  Well, except past noon at around when they will start packing up and people look for places that offer lunch or rice meals.  It has a relaxed atmosphere together with an attentive staff.  Now, what more can you ask for?

I recommend the manis (sweet) Coffee Tarik where they mix the coffee with a teaspoon of condensed milk and voila! Creamy and sweet coffee in just one swish- a very Indonesian way, I observed.  Plus, I discovered that I need to ask first if they still have bread as the Roti Bakar is one of the items in the menu that usually runs out first.  Order the Roti Bakar with Kaya and the soft-boiled eggs.  It’s one of my staple sweet-and-salty combination that keeps one’s tongue guessing on what is to come next.

IMG_2772

Another Chronically Gallivanting recommendation is the Bubur Manado or Manadonese Porridge.  It’s a heavy breakfast meal for me and that is why it is best to share with friends.  It’s porridge mixed with a lot of other things as one can see in the photo.  Corn kernels and vegetables make this a full meal that is ready to sustain you with energy until lunch time and maybe even beyond.
